+#ifdef CONFIG_PM_SLEEP
+static int ave_suspend(struct device *dev)
+{
+ struct ethtool_wolinfo wol = { .cmd = ETHTOOL_GWOL };
+ struct net_device *ndev = dev_get_drvdata(dev);
+ struct ave_private *priv = netdev_priv(ndev);
+ int ret = 0;
+
+ if (netif_running(ndev)) {
+ ret = ave_stop(ndev);
+ netif_device_detach(ndev);
+ }
+
+ ave_ethtool_get_wol(ndev, &wol);
+ priv->wolopts = wol.wolopts;
+
+ return ret;
+}
+
+static int ave_resume(struct device *dev)
+{
+ struct ethtool_wolinfo wol = { .cmd = ETHTOOL_GWOL };
+ struct net_device *ndev = dev_get_drvdata(dev);
+ struct ave_private *priv = netdev_priv(ndev);
+ int ret = 0;
+
+ ave_global_reset(ndev);
+
+ ave_ethtool_get_wol(ndev, &wol);
+ wol.wolopts = priv->wolopts;
+ ave_ethtool_set_wol(ndev, &wol);
+
+ if (ndev->phydev) {
+ ret = phy_resume(ndev->phydev);
+ if (ret)
+ return ret;
+ }
+
+ if (netif_running(ndev)) {
+ ret = ave_open(ndev);
+ netif_device_attach(ndev);
+ }
+
+ return ret;
+}
+
+static SIMPLE_DEV_PM_OPS(ave_pm_ops, ave_suspend, ave_resume);
+#define AVE_PM_OPS (&ave_pm_ops)
+#else
+#define AVE_PM_OPS NULL
+#endif
